Ninth Circuit affirms summary judgment for Los Angeles County Sheriff Lee Baca in section 1983 "deliberate indifference" case
April 3, 2009
McCullock v. Los Angeles County Sheriff, Sheriff Baca (9th Cir. 2009) 320 Fed.Appx. 814 (Ninth Circuit Court of Appeals) [unpublished]. The Ninth Circuit affirmed summary judgment in favor of Los Angeles County Sheriff Lee Baca on plaintiff's section 1983 claim, which alleged that plaintiff was denied constitutionally adequate medical treatment while jailed. Specifically, he claimed that Baca failed to treat him with insulin for his diabetes (although he was a Type II, non-insulin-dependent diabetic). The Ninth Circuit held that there was no triable issue of material fact as to whether plaintiff suffered any harm, or whether Sheriff Baca personally participated in any constitutional violation.
